Neuroevoluzione in Progetti AI: Guida Implementazione e Vantaggi

Scopri l’integrazione della neuroevoluzione nei progetti di intelligenza artificiale: vantaggi, sfide e prospettive future per il machine learning.

L’Integrazione della Neuroevoluzione nei Progetti di Intelligenza Artificiale: Una Prospettiva Approfondita

L’evoluzione delle tecnologie legate all’intelligenza artificiale (AI) ha aperto nuove possibilità e sfide nel campo del machine learning. Tra le varie metodologie utilizzate, la neuroevoluzione emerge come un approccio affascinante e promettente. Ma come possiamo implementare con successo la neuroevoluzione nei nostri progetti di AI? In questo articolo esploreremo le potenzialità di questa tecnica, i suoi vantaggi e le sfide che possiamo incontrare lungo il percorso.

Introduzione alla Neuroevoluzione

La neuroevoluzione è un campo ibrido che combina concetti di reti neurali artificiali e algoritmi genetici. Questa combinazione permette di creare modelli AI in grado di apprendere e adattarsi in ambienti complessi, arrivando a soluzioni ottimali anche in contesti non deterministici.

Caratteristiche Chiave della Neuroevoluzione:

  • Capacità di adattamento in ambienti dinamici.
  • Gestione efficiente di spazi di ricerca complessi.
  • Maggiore robustezza rispetto ad altri approcci di machine learning.

Implementare la Neuroevoluzione nei Progetti di AI

Quando si decide di integrare la neuroevoluzione nei progetti di AI, è importante considerare diversi fattori chiave che possono influenzare il successo dell’implementazione.

Passaggi Fondamentali:

  1. Definire chiaramente l’obiettivo del progetto e le metriche di valutazione.
  2. Progettare l’architettura della rete neurale e i parametri genetici.
  3. Selezionare i criteri di fitness per guidare l’evoluzione.
  4. Eseguire iterazioni per addestrare e ottimizzare il modello.

Vantaggi e Sfide nell’Utilizzo della Neuroevoluzione

L’implementazione della neuroevoluzione offre diversi vantaggi rispetto ad altri approcci di machine learning, ma presenta anche alcune sfide che è importante conoscere e affrontare.

Vantaggi:

  • Adattabilità a contesti complessi e dinamici.
  • Possibilità di esplorare ampi spazi di ricerca.
  • Maggiore robustezza e resistenza al rumore nei dati.

Sfide:

  • Complessità computazionale.
  • Rischio di convergenza prematura.
  • Necessità di un’accurata progettazione dei parametri genetici.

Prospettive Future e Considerazioni Finali

L’integrazione della neuroevoluzione nei progetti di AI rappresenta un’opportunità stimolante per sviluppare modelli intelligenti e adattivi. Tuttavia, è importante valutare attentamente i costi computazionali e le sfide connesse all’implementazione di questa tecnica. Con una progettazione oculata e una corretta gestione delle fasi di addestramento, la neuroevoluzione può portare a risultati sorprendenti e innovativi nel campo dell’intelligenza artificiale.

In conclusione, la neuroevoluzione si candida come un approccio promettente per la creazione di modelli AI sofisticati e in grado di adattarsi a scenari reali complessi. Sfruttare appieno il potenziale di questa tecnica richiede competenze, dedizione e una profonda comprensione dei meccanismi sottostanti. Investire tempo ed energie nello studio e nell’applicazione della neuroevoluzione può aprire nuove frontiere di ricerca e sviluppo nell’ambito dell’intelligenza artificiale.

Translate »